Can My Employer Make Me Work 3 Months Notice - The average notice period in the UK is just one month, although agreed notice periods can typically range from anything between one week to six months. A three month notice period is a clause now commonly found in many UK employment contracts, reflecting the average length of time required to fill a role and ensure business continuity. YOUR STATE MAY HAVE ITS OWN LAWS THAT PROVIDE SIMILAR OR GREATER PROTECTION In nearly every situation an employer cannot force an employee to work for three months or three days or three minutes That is exactly what at will means either party can end the employment relationship at any time without notice at its will its whim its wish

"At will" employment means that you and the employer are each free to end the employment at any time. This means that the employer can terminate you for a good reason, a bad reason, or no reason at all. It also means that the employer does not have to give you advance notice of the termination.
